Transaction 3bba762dbf74c892f6e1aaa159b6f5f43464e24add4f334f7ec52806ebee2b90
1 Input
1 Output
-
3bba762dbf74c892f6e1aaa159b6f5f43464e24add4f334f7ec52806ebee2b90:0
- value
- 3743513
- script pubkey
- OP_0 OP_PUSHBYTES_20 c069cc40bea227244a4777ade26c7464f6a85c15
- address
- bc1qcp5ucs975gnjgjj8w7k7ymr5vnm2shq4mvcasj